what does the "stalk"and "craggle " mean in the sentence?
they lived five doors apart at the top of a steep stalk of a hill: the Craggle twin.

My suspicion is that this could well be the result of OCR (optical character recognition) errors on text that was scanned into a computer as an image. Either that or it is some kind of weird stream-of-consciousness nonsense.
"Craggie" with an "i" could be a Scottish surname. "Craggle" with an "l" is neither a word nor a common surname. "Stalk" is a word, it is the tough vertical part of a plant, but "steep stalk" doesn't make sense.
